Из Википедии, бесплатной энциклопедии
Перейти к навигации Перейти к поиску

В реляционных базах данных , relvar это термин , введенный CJ Дата и Хью Дарвен как аббревиатура для переменной отношения в их статье 1995 Третий манифест , чтобы избежать путаницы , иногда возникающие в связи с использованием термина связи , изобретателем в реляционной модели , EF Codd , для переменной, которой присвоено отношение, а также для самого отношения. Этот термин используется в известном учебнике Дейта по базам данных «Введение в системы баз данных» и в различных других книгах, написанных им или в соавторстве с ними.

Термин Relvar не является общепринятым, и он не используется в контексте существующих продуктов системы управления базами данных, которые поддерживают SQL [ необходима ссылка ] , чьей концепцией (но не точным эквивалентом) является базовая таблица , т.е. как и переменные компьютерного языка в целом, имеет имя и подлежит обновлению (т. е. время от времени ему присваиваются разные значения). Другие учебники по базам данных продолжают использовать термин « отношение» как для переменной, так и для содержащихся в ней данных. Точно так же в текстах на SQL обычно используется таблица терминов для обеих целей, хотя квалифицированная базовая таблица терминов используется в стандарте для переменной.

Тесно связанный термин, часто используемый в академических текстах, - это схема отношений , представляющая собой набор атрибутов в паре с набором ограничений, вместе определяющих набор отношений с целью некоторого обсуждения (обычно, нормализации базы данных ). Ограничения, в которых упоминается только одна относительная переменная, называются ограничениями относительной переменной , поэтому схему отношения можно рассматривать как отдельный термин, охватывающий относительную переменную и ее ограничения.

Ссылки [ править ]

  • CJ Date . Введение в системы баз данных , 8-е изд. (Аддисон-Уэсли, 2004, ISBN  0-321-19784-4 ), стр. 65–6.
  • CJ Date и Хью Дарвен . Базы данных, типы и реляционная модель: третий манифест (Аддисон-Уэсли, 2007, ISBN 0-321-39942-0 ), стр.85